Abstract

Central dogma units comprise of DNA, RNA and synthesis of protein. Reproductive cycle in shes is always dynamic and the units of central dogma are always changing in different phases of testicular and ovarian cycle which constitute reproductive cycle in shes. The adult specimens of Mystus (M.) vittatus, a tropical siluroid, when exposed for 30 days to sublethal concentration of trivalent arsenic (11.24 mg/l) revealed signicant decline in DNA, RNA and consequently protein in the ovary of Mystus (M.) vittatus during its preparatory phase of Testicular cycle. However, 15 days exposure revealed less signicant alterations. Causes for declining in various units of central dogma and consequently protein synthesis is discussed in this paper.
